Java 项目代码的初学者指南254
Java 是一种高需求的编程语言,拥有庞大的开发人员社区和广泛的应用程序。对于寻求建立强大且可扩展的软件解决方案的开发人员来说,Java 是一种宝贵的工具。本指南将提供 Java 项目代码的初学者指南,涵盖基础知识、实践技巧和高级概念。
Java 项目结构
Java 项目通常采用分层结构,其中代码分布在不同的包和类中。一个典型的 Java 项目结构可能如下所示:src/
main/
java/
com/example/project/
resources/
src/main/java 目录包含源代码,其中 是项目的包名称。 是项目的主类,而 和 是其他类,用于实现特定功能。
创建 Java 项目
可以使用 Java 开发工具包 (JDK) 或集成开发环境 (IDE) 创建 Java 项目。对于初学者,使用 IDE 如 Eclipse 或 IntelliJ IDEA 推荐使用,因为它提供代码完成、调试和项目管理等功能。
在 IDE 中创建新项目时,您可以指定项目的名称、包名称和主类。
Java 程序的基本语法
Java 是一种面向对象的语言,这意味着它围绕着对象的概念展开。Java 程序の基本構文包括:* 类:定义对象蓝图的数据类型。
* 对象:类的一个实例,包含数据和行为。
* 方法:对象可以执行的操作或行为。
* 变量:存储数据的容器。
* 控制流:用于控制程序执行流的语句,例如 if、else 和 while 循环。
实践技巧
以下技巧将帮助初学者构建更好的 Java 项目代码:* 遵循命名约定:类、方法和变量应遵循一致的命名惯例,以提高代码的可读性。
* 使用注释:注释清楚地解释代码的意图和功能。
* 使用版本控制:使用版本控制系统(例如 Git)来跟踪代码更改并协作开发。
* 获取最佳实践:参考 Java 社区中的最佳实践和编码标准。
高级概念
一旦掌握了基础知识,初学者可以探索 Java 的高级概念,以构建更复杂的应用程序:* 泛型:允许创建可处理不同类型数据的类和方法。
* 反射:用于在运行时检查和修改类的结构和行为。
* 并发性:允许程序同时执行多个任务。
* 注解:提供元数据,用于增强类和方法的行为。
通过遵循本指南,初学者可以创建健壮且可扩展的 Java 项目代码。从构建项目结构到掌握高级概念,这份指南提供了基石,帮助开发人员入门 Java 开发。持续练习、探索资源和贡献开源项目是成为熟练的 Java 程序员的关键。
2024-10-12
上一篇:Java 解析 JSON 字符串

PHP数据库多表查询:技巧、优化与最佳实践
https://www.shuihudhg.cn/106354.html

Java常用方法封装:提升代码可读性和可维护性
https://www.shuihudhg.cn/106353.html

Python连接MySQL数据库:完整指南及常见问题解决
https://www.shuihudhg.cn/106352.html

Python打造多功能时钟:从基础到高级应用详解
https://www.shuihudhg.cn/106351.html

C语言内置函数详解及应用
https://www.shuihudhg.cn/106350.html
热门文章

Java中数组赋值的全面指南
https://www.shuihudhg.cn/207.html

JavaScript 与 Java:二者有何异同?
https://www.shuihudhg.cn/6764.html

判断 Java 字符串中是否包含特定子字符串
https://www.shuihudhg.cn/3551.html

Java 字符串的切割:分而治之
https://www.shuihudhg.cn/6220.html

Java 输入代码:全面指南
https://www.shuihudhg.cn/1064.html